Quan Lai Sun Padawan apprentice to Wookie Jedi Maarsquith.  Aged only twelve, Quan was confident and sure of his growing abilities.  Born on the planet Wennicas he joined the Jedi as a pupil aged ten.  His talent for being a truthsayer meant that he could identify deception, even by listening to somebody’s voice.

Queed - Heavily armoured, scarred human Bounty Hunter.  Once thought to be an Imperial agent masquerading as a Bounty Hunter to hunt down Alliance sympathisers, Queed joined in the hunt to locate the renegade Carbonite-frozen smuggler Han Solo, journeying to the planet Chevron and gaining information out of the informer Lerone Eyelove in the process. Recently piloting the hunter ship the Raptor, he previously owned the freighter Afterburner, then had to purchase a new vessel, the ManTrap, after the Afterburner was destroyed by Tarr Ranths ship the Prodigal Son over Gista. In actuality Queed was Riger, ex-partner of Glann Cipple, Dessio D’Staan and Dressel and father of the late Luschia Arkensaw, who was left for dead after being pushed off a cliff by Dressel.  Keeping his identity a secret his motives were unclear until he revealed his true identity to Jan Lomona, Luschia Arkensaw, Anzai Karoo and Arach Raynor aboard the Euphoria Station. It was at this time that Queed killed Lerone Eyelove.  Longbody and the dark force user Arcc Nedeen were suspected to be allies of Queed, and he came out of hiding to hunt down Glann Cipple just prior to Cipples attempted invasion of the Setnin Sector.  Queed finally caught up with Cipple and delivered him to Trefnare – the very spot where Dressel had pushed him off years before.  Revealing himself to be Riger, he and Dressel fought, killing Anzai Karoo in the process before falling down to the jagged rocks below.

Quenn, Arroth - Male human Police officer from A-desando who worked on the streets of Amagad City for the ganglord Glann Cipple in an unofficial capacity.

Qui-Lan, Hutos- - Aunt of the Jedi Knight Joah-Qui-Lan and a Jedi Knight protecting the world of Aliass in the Corb Sector.  Using a blue-hued Lightsabre Hutos fought the Bedois dark force user Arcc Nedeen in battle on Aliass before being cut down and killed protecting Ambassador Lith.

Qui-Lan, Joah- – Powerful Jedi Knight who trained with his parents on the planet Yaroobe and then under master Luke Skywalker at the Jedi Academy.  Given the task of finding new students for the academy, Qui-Lan entered the Setnin Sector to continue his search.  After nine months he had a handful of leads – one of them being the swoop racer Skeet Jonas.  Linking up with Jan Lomona and Daemon Garr, Qui-Lan travelled to the world of Alganar III, finding a cave filled with Sith artefacts left behind during a conflict between the sith and an alien race known as the Bedois.   Born on the quiet world of Yaroobe, Joah came from a long line of Jedi Knights – his grandmother being the revered Jedi Knight Alinda-Can. Hidden from the murderous hands of the Empire by his parents, themselves librarians in the Jedi Temple on Coruscant.  Joah lives to honour the memory of his brother Kilarf-Qui-Lan, a man he never knew.

Qui-Lan, Kilarf-Jedi Knight who rose to his potential at a tender age.  Raised on the Republics central planet of Coruscant, Kilarf showed his powers early.  Apprenticed to the Jedi Knight Muroal, Kilarf was an eager Padawan and soaked knowledge readily.  At only eighteen years of age, after the slaughter of the Jedi Knights, his betrayal and death at the hands of the Empire drove his Master away from Coruscant and his parents into hiding on the world of Yaroobe.  Three years after his brother’s death, Joah-Qui-Lan was born, and Joah served the New Republic and the Galactic Alliance much like his brother longed to serve the Old.

Quill, Dentate Quarren mercenary who was double-crossed by the smuggler Jan Lomona.  Quill took out a thirty thousand credit bounty on Lomona, which the hunter Queed picked up.  However, later upon Tarr Ranths insistence the sanction was rescinded, leaving Queed at the mercy of Ranth in the dunes of Tatooine.

Quindenn, Miss – Dance instructor at the Stumble Inn cantina in the Tatooine township of Duneside Quindenn chose Innga Marrael, otherwise known as Weale Galletti, to be her newest dancer, a position Innga accepted before being abducted and taken to the palace of Jabba the Hutt.
